Thinking through this some more, I'm skeptical that this is going to be that useful as a debugging-only feature.

In my experience, there are four major scenarios for diagnosing this kind of failure. Under the assumption that you control one end, the other end can be:

1. A live endpoint.
2. A testing endpoint someone has put up.
3. An endpoint that someone is actively working on with you.
4. An endpoint you control (e.g., you're running it on your own machine).

If this is a debug-only feature, then it won't be available in case #1, and it's not that helpful in case 4, because you can read the logs, errors, etc. yourself. For the same reason, it's not really that helpful in case #3, because you can just ask the person you're working with to read the logs, so this leaves case #2, which I agree can be annoying. However, what we've started doing with QUIC is just to have the endpoints dump their logs so that they're available on a co-located Web site. That gives you a lot more information than you'd probably want to fit in an alert message (e.g., you can print out the keying material, etc.)

I guess there might be some intermediate category 1.5 that's kind of in production so you don't want to print out complete logs, but you'd like more detail than you would probably want to expose in general, but my experience is that that's not super-common.
